"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" and "Ulefone Note 12 128GB", which is more comfortable to hold? Weight comparison
The weight of the device affects hand fatigue and the burden placed upon the wrist. The lighter it is, the longer you'll be able to operate the device without tiring. Also, if the burden placed on the wrist is lower, you'll be able to use the device more comfortably. However if the weight isn't right for you, it could place more of a burden on your body, causing you to feel stress.
The weight of the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" is about 290.0g, and the weight of the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B" is about 237.0g. Comparing the weight of the two devices, the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B" is a lighter smart phone than the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B", with a difference of about 53g. For that reason the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B" is a smart phone that is less likely than the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B"to put a burden on your fingers and wrist when used for an extended period. That's why we recommend the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B" over the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B".

"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" and "Ulefone Note 12 128GB", which has a clearer display?
Pixel density affects picture quality, and the higher the pixel density, the better the picture quality, which means the user can gain more enjoyment from games and videos. In addition, higher picture quality decreases eyestrain, which means that the user will experience less eye fatigue after prolonged use.
The resolution on the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" is 1080 x 2408, and pixel density is 401ppi. Also, the resolution on the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B" is 720 x 1640, and pixel density is 262ppi. Comparing the pixel count, the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" has much higher pixel density than the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B", with a difference of roughly 139ppi. In terms of having better picture quality and exerting less strain on the eyes, the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" is superior to the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B". If you are looking for a smartphone that is easy on the eyes, displaying texts and pictures clearly without any blurring, we recommend the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" over the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B".

"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" and "Ulefone Note 12 128GB", which has better CPU?
CPU performance affects the ability to process programs, and the ability to process programs is determined by the product of the number of cores in the CPU and the CPU frequency. The higher this performance is, the more smoothly apps and games will run, and with low performance apps and games become heavy and stress is experienced.
The "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B"'s CPU is a MediaTek MT8781 Helio G99, with performance measured at 2.2GHz+2.0GHz×8(8.0-cores). Also, the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B"'s CPU is a Unisoc Tiger T310, with performance measured at 2.0GHz+1.8GHz×4(4.0-cores). Comparing CPU performance, the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" has considerably higher specs than the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B". In terms of being able to comfortably play games and run apps smoothly, the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" is superior to the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B". If you're going for a high spec smart phone that runs smoothly and comfortably handles games, we recommend purchasing the "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" over the "Ulefone Note 12 128GB".

"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B" and "Ulefone Note 12 128GB", performance comparison by specification sheet
Ulefone Armor 17 Pro 256GB | Ulefone Note 12 128GB | |
Image | ||
Maker | Ulefone | Ulefone |
Release date | 2022-10-31 | 2022-07 |
Color | Black | Black/Red/Blue |
OS | Android | Android |
Dimensions (width x height x thickness) | 80.4mm x 172.7mm x 12.5mm | 79.1mm x 173.6mm x 10.2mm |
Weight | 290.0g | 237.0g |
Display size | 6.58inch | 6.82inch |
Display type | IPS LCD | IPS LCD |
Screen resolution (width x height) | 1080 x 2408 | 720 x 1640 |
Pixel density | 401ppi | 262ppi |
Chipset | MediaTek MT8781 Helio G99 | Unisoc Tiger T310 |
CPU specs | 2.2GHz+2.0GHz×8(8.0-cores) | 2.0GHz+1.8GHz×4(4.0-cores) |
RAM size | 8.0GB | 4.0GB |
Storage size | 256.0GB | 128.0GB |
Rear-camera resolution | 108.0MP | 13.0MP |
Front-camera resolution | 16.0MP | 8.0MP |
